Transaction 84130e159ad8298d749f71d9aac91a58217c70189b7ae311fc29a53c9d7624bb
1 Input
1 Output
-
84130e159ad8298d749f71d9aac91a58217c70189b7ae311fc29a53c9d7624bb:0
- value
- 9631245
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 ab1b0babd4ff4a7c5f351db063e6058423dce57f OP_EQUAL
- address
- 3HHjsWNx1m8vcjUKmbiqFCTKs2cK95QE1W